CAMPBELL’S Red and White, Vegetarian Vegetable Soup, condensed

Fun Facts

  1. Just like vitamins, minerals help your body grow and stay healthy. The body uses minerals to perform many different functions, for example for building strong bones, or transmitting nerve impulses. Some minerals are even used to make hormones or maintain a normal heartbeat.
  2. Calcium is a very important mineral in human metabolism, making up about 2% of an adult human’s body weight. In 100 grams of CAMPBELL’S Red and White, Vegetarian Vegetable Soup, condensed, you can find 16 milligrams of calcium. It provides the 2% of the daily recommended value for the average adult.
  3. Vegetables, especially green leafy varieties, are generally our richest sources of potassium. But this mineral can also be found in varying amounts in almost all foods. 698 milligrams of potassium can be found on every 100 grams of CAMPBELL’S Red and White, Vegetarian Vegetable Soup, condensed, the 15% of the total daily recommended potassium intake.
  4. Sodium is needed for muscle contractions, nerve transmissions, maintaining pH balance and hydration. Sodium also regulates the fluid outside of the cells and is needed to pump fluid into the cells as potassium carries by-products out. 100 grams of CAMPBELL’S Red and White, Vegetarian Vegetable Soup, condensed contains 516 milligrams of sodium, that’s the 34% of the daily recommended value for an adult.
